*Quincy synergizes very well with Overload in decks for anti-Aggro purposes. Arrow Shot can get Bloons down to 100 or below health, and an Overload can use that damage to pop a Bloon without having to spend too much Gold or Bloontonium. Perceptive Shot can also put specific Bloons at 100 health or less, such as [[Double Yellow Bloon|Double Yellow Bloons]] or [[Green Bloon (BCS)|Green Bloons]] boosted by [[Zee Jay (BCS)|Zee Jay’s]] Passive Awesomeness.
*Overload is also a good option against Bloons with Armor, especially [[Lead Coating Bloon]].
